Transaction 8311330493afc3f9f26c9bb084b712b3b9e8e68a7bfb3ac821e93a48d06be4b7
1 Input
1 Output
-
8311330493afc3f9f26c9bb084b712b3b9e8e68a7bfb3ac821e93a48d06be4b7:0
- value
- 1605266
- script pubkey
- OP_0 OP_PUSHBYTES_20 470d28c15a96b92e2b71bcb6d70d7092c40176ee
- address
- bc1qguxj3s26j6uju2m3hjmdwrtsjtzqzahw5aav0n